What is Section 8 Company ?
A company is referred to as Section 8 Company when it registered as a Non-Profit Organization (NPO) i.e. when it has motive of promoting arts, commerce, education, charity, protection of environment, sports, science, research, social welfare, religion and intends to use its profits (if any) or other income for promoting these objectives.
Procedure for incorporation of a Section 8 company
Step 1 – Obtain a DSC of the proposed Directors of the Section 8 Company. Once a DSC is received, file Form DIR-3 with the ROC for getting a DIN.
Documents to attach for DIN application:
Proof of Identity and Address Proof.
Step 2 – Once the DIR-3 is approved, the ROC will allot a DIN to the proposed directors.
Step 3 – File Form INC-1 with the ROC for applying for a company name. A total of 6 names can be applied for in order of preference, out of which one would be allotted, based on availability.
Step 4 – After approval, file Form INC-12 with the ROC to apply for a licence for the Section 8 company.
Documents to attach with INC-12:
a. Draft MOA as per Form INC-13
b. Draft AOA
c. Declaration as per Form INC-14 (Declaration from Practicing Chartered Accountant)
d. Declaration as per Form INC-15 (Declaration from each person making application )
e. Estimated Income & Expenditure for next 3 years.
The subscription pages of the Memorandum and Articles of Association of the company shall be signed by every subscriber along with mentioning his name, address, and occupation, in the presence of at least one witness who shall attest the signature and sign and add his name, address, and occupation.
Step 5 – Once the Form is approved, a license under section 8 will be issued in Form INC-16.
Step 6 – After obtaining the license, file SPICE Form 32 with the ROC for incorporation along with the following attachments:
a. An affidavit from all the directors’ cum subscribers – INC-9
b. Declaration of deposits
c. KYC of all the Directors
d. Form DIR-2 with its attachments i.e PAN Card and address proof of the directors
e. Consent letter of all the directors
f. Interest in other entities of the directors
g. Utility bill as a proof of Office address
h. NOC in case the premises are leased/rented
i. Draft MOA and AOA
If the ROC is satisfied with the forms submitted, he issues a Certificate of Incorporation along with a unique Company Identification Number (CIN).
Forms Required for Registration
Name of the form | Purpose of the Form |
INC 1 | Name Approval |
INC 7 | Application for Incorporation of Company |
INC 8 | Declaration |
INC 9 | Affidavit from each director and subscriber |
INC 12 | Application for License |
INC 13 | Memorandum of Association |
INC 14 | Declaration from a practicing Chartered Accountant |
INC 15 | Declaration from each person making the application |
INC 16 | License to incorporate as Section 8 company |
INC 22 | Situation of Registered Office |
DIR 2 | Consent of Directors |
DIR 3 | Application to ROC to get DIN |
DIR 12 | Appointment of Directors |
